One of the photo-micrographs created by Arthur E Smith and featured in the book Nature through Microscope & Camera (1909) by Richard Kerr. Little information is given about Arthur E Smith but we do know that the photographs featured in the book “were exhibited at the Royal Society’s Annual Conversazione, May 13, 1904”, so Kerr tells us in the opening chapter, and “done on 12 by 10 plates directly through the microscope and camera combined as one instrument” with the negatives receiving “no ‘touching-up’ whatever.” (Image Source: California Digital Library, via Internet Archive)
